    IR3570 wont copy from automatic feeder

    Hi guys

    Was wondering if you could help? We have an ir 3570 that has just stopped printing/copying from the automatic feeder. It feeds no problem, selects the paper and spits out the paper but just wont print anything on the paper.

    It was printing double sided from the feeder and the next lot of paper put in the feeder for printing was a little to much so the machine would not proceed. Removed some pages and it started printing double sidedas selected but without the print. Any suggestions?

    Copies fine manually and prints jobs from pc just the feeder wont print.

    Thanks in advance

    issue can occur if one of the Paper Length Sensors on the DADF is stuck.

        Try doing a Sens-Init from service mode.
        Service Mode (Level 1) > Feeder > Function >Sens-Init>OK

        Then perform a tray width adjustment.
        Service Mode (Level 1) > Feeder > Function > TRY-LTR and TRY-LTRR.

        Follow the steps below to perform the Tray Width adjustment.
        Move the Side Guides to the Letter position. Highlight TRY-LTR and press OK.
        Next, move the Side Guides to the Letter R position and highlight TRY-LTRR on the LCD display and press OK.

        Reboot machine.

            Seen it many times...machine thinks the originals are 17 inch...2200/2800/3300 had same issues. Or curled legal originals not actuating the sensor arm. I wrap a tie wrap around the weight end of the arm...snug it up and cut it to leave no tail...makes them less sensitive...but originals gotta be flat. A little customer training on curled legal originals and problem solved
